The Zacatecas wine appellation, located in the arid heart of Mexico, is an emerging wine region. It benefits from a semi-arid climate with warm days and cool nights, which allows for optimal grape maturation. The vineyards, situated at an altitude of nearly 2,000 metres, enjoy abundant sunlight and clay-limestone soil that imparts complexity and minerality to the wines. This region is particularly renowned for its robust red wines from grape varieties such as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, and Malbec, but its white and sparkling wines are also gaining recognition. Local producers strive to combine traditional techniques with modern innovations to best express the unique terroir of Zacatecas, offering rich and elegant wines with considerable ageing potential. The region embodies the dynamic evolution of the Mexican wine industry, capturing the attention of wine enthusiasts worldwide.
